I scavenged an optical sensor out of a wireless mouse I had, and now I'm trying to track down the data sheet. Honestly, the pinout (from what I could determine looking at the board in which it was soldered) seems pretty similar to a "ADNS2620" (like this one at sparkfun: https://www.sparkfun.com/products/retired/12907) but I'd like to track down a data sheet to make the process of figuring it out a little easier. Pictures provided below, direction helpful.

optical_sensor_top

optical_sensor_bottom

For those curious, the text appears to say "FCT3065-XY" and "16365A6".

    \$\begingroup\$ The AVAGO ADNS2620 data sheet might be a good start - these chips often have I2C serial interface, and require a 24 MHz ceramic resonator. Compare Avago's data sheet schematic with the mouse circuit from which you pulled the chip. \$\endgroup\$

    \$\begingroup\$ In a multimeter do-everything-chip, have seen a clone optimize out the oscillator, where the original had a crystal. Shouldn't be hard to add a high-frequency oscillator entirely on-chip, for cost-sensitive high-volume production, like mouses. If the other pins are similar to Avago's - try talking I2C to/from it anyway. \$\endgroup\$

I'm afraid all I have is bad news. Logitech uses the FCT3065-XY in their mice, so I contacted Logitec to see if they knew where to get the datasheet. Their response is that they won't release the information because it's "Logitech Proprietary."

I was able to find this online, now assuming this stands true, that would mean the FCT3065-XY should be identical to the FCT3065, which led me to find this: https://octopart.com/fct3065-pixart-84957100 . According to the site it should be a PixArt sensor but the specs are unknown.

I do have a mouse with that sensor, and it has a DPI range of 800-2000, and seemingly if you searched for mice with PixArt 3065, most of them have DPI ranges around that.
